STUFFED CABBAGE
This recipe calls for freezing a head of cabbage overnight to soften the leaves to wrap around a beef and rice mixture.

Steps:
- Place cabbage head in freezer and freeze overnight. Remove from freezer, thaw and peel away leaves.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Combine the beef, egg, onion, rice, salt and pepper. Mix together well. Take a small handful and form into a small roll or ball. Place into the center of a cabbage leaf. Fold the sides of the leaf over and roll the ball up into the leaf. Place seam side down in baking dish. Continue until all of the filling is used up.
- Mix together the soup with a 1/2 can water; pour over stuffed cabbage.
- Bake uncovered at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 1 hour; baste often with the sauce.

CABBAGE STUFFED WITH TWO MEATS

Steps:
- Combine half the onion and garlic, all of the carrot and 1 cup of stock in a large saucepan.
- B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at and simmer, uncovered, until the vegetables are very soft.
- Add remaining stock, the wine, tomato sauce, 1 teaspoon thyme and 1/2 teaspoon salt.
- Simmer over very low heat.
- Meanwhile, prepare the cabbage rolls.
- Put the whole head of cabbage in a large pot of boiling water.
- Boil for about 5 minutes until leaves are loosened.
- Remove cabbage and carefully peel off 12 leaves.
- Return these to the boiling water and cook until soft, about 5 more minutes.
- Remove from pot and drain carefully so they remain whole.
- Chop enough of the remaining cabbage to make 1 cup.
- Heat oil in a frying pan over medium heat.
- Add remaining onion and cook until soft, about 5 minutes.
- Add remaining garlic and cook 1 minute.
- Add 1/2 teaspoon thyme and the marjoram and stir briefly.
- Combine this mixture with the ground meats, rice, and chopped cabbage.
- To this add 1 teaspoon salt, 1/4 teaspoon pepper and 1/2 teaspoon thyme.
- Form meat mixture into 12 ovals.
- Cut large rib from each of the 12 cabbage leaves.
- Put 1 meat oval on each leaf and roll up half way.
- Fold 2 ends in and finish rolling Place in large casserole dish.
- Cover with tomato sauce mixture and cover with foil.
- Bake in 350 degree oven for about an hour.

BEEF STUFFED CABBAGE ROLLS
We have been making this dish in my family since I was a little girl. Mother served it with corn bread fritters-I like to serve it with corn bread muffins.

Steps:
- Remove core from cabbage. Steam 12 large outer leaves until limp. Drain well. , In a bowl, combine ground beef, rice, onion, egg and seasonings; mix well. Put about 1/3 cup meat mixture on each cabbage leaf. Fold in sides, starting at an unfolded edge, and roll up leaf completely to enclose filling. Repeat with remaining leaves and filling. Place rolls in a large skillet or Dutch oven. , Combine tomato sauce, brown sugar, water and lemon juice or vinegar; pour over cabbage rolls. Cover and simmer for 1 hour, spooning sauce over rolls occasionally during cooking.

CABBAGE ROLLS FOR 2
The hardest part is seperating the cabbage leaves from the head but otherwise a tasty cabbage recipe for 2

Steps:
- In a large saucepan, cook the cabbage leaves in boiling water for 5 minutes; drain and set aside.
- Meanwhile, in a skillet, cook the beef, sausage and onion over medium heat until the meat is no longer pink.
- Stir in the rice, Worcestershire sauce, mustard and egg. Mix well.
- Cut out the thick vein from the bottom of each reserved leaf, makeing a v-shaped cut.
- Place 1/3 cup beef mixture onto each cabbage leaf; overlap cut ends of each leaf and then fold in the sides.
- Beginning from the cut end, roll up to completely enclose the filling.
- Place seam side down in a greased baking dish.
- Pour the tomato juice over the rolls and sprinkle with brown sugar, if desired.
- Cover and bake at 350 degrees for 50 minutes. Uncover and bake for 10 minutes longer.
POLISH STUFFED CABBAGE
Stuffed cabbage rolls. I am 100 percent Polish, and this is my mom's recipe. Use regular rice, not instant.

Steps:
- Place the head of cabbage in a large pot over high heat and add water to cover. Boil cabbage for 15 minutes, or until it is pliable and soft. Drain and allow to cool completely. Remove the hard outer vein from the leaves.
- In a separate large bowl, combine the beef, rice, garlic powder and the egg, mixing well. Place a small amount, about the size of your palm, into the center of a cabbage leaf and fold leaf over, tucking in the sides of the leaf to keep meat mixture inside.
- Pile up the filled leaves in a large pot, putting the larger leaves on the bottom. Add the tomato juice, vinegar and sugar and enough water to cover. Simmer over medium low heat for about 60 minutes. (Note: Keep an eye on them, making sure the bottom of leaves do not burn.)
